Course Overview
Offshore oil & gas operations present complex engineering challenges where material performance, welding quality, and structural integrity are critical to operational safety and reliability.
This programme provides a comprehensive understanding of material selection, welding processes, corrosion management, and integrity challenges in offshore oil & gas environments. It focuses on improving operational reliability, minimising failure risks, and supporting long-term asset performance.
Participants will gain practical insights into managing technical challenges while ensuring compliance with industry standards and operational best practices.
